Chapter 6: Preparation
Aquamarine
It is official, after running it through my mind hundreds of times there is only one solution to this problem. Murder. Either I liquidate them or that monstrosity will freeze me solid. There are no other options, that fear was primal. Whatever that thing is it is an existential threat. We can not coexist, and even if we could I simply refuse to on principle. I refuse to be buried under a sheet of ice, to live in the shadow of the cold. As I stir I failed to realize that the Humamanders had returned. Plopping down they set aside a portion of their spoils. They eat and play all the while I relive the encounter over and over in my mind. When I finally come to notice the food laid out before me I'm intrigued. A few black orbs and strangely shaped yellow berries were placed next to my core. Seeing these things filled my heart with joy.
A plan comes to mind, since I can create these creatures, perhaps I can spawn enough of them to attack the cold gem. Images of the Humamander army getting frozen solid by cold spells dash my hopes a bit. I hurriedly think back to the water mages that used to control me in the past, the armor they wore was not a traditional mages garb, they wore fur coats to protect themselves against their rival element cold. The scenario plays out in my mind once again, a group of armored Humamanders rushing into the chamber of the ice gem, surviving the spells meant to freeze them solid. They reach the gem and try crushing it with their bare hands, failing.
They would obviously need weapons as well, that much is obvious. I created these things with human hands so they could wield tools after all. With the matter settled I reach out and speak into the minds of my creations.

Creation
"Creation, Too. I shall be gifting you more members of your own kind. I task both of you with a mission in the mean time. Find the materials for some weapons, and try to craft them." The voice booms in my mind. This time it speaks of things I am unfamiliar with. I had learned that Too seems to be much younger than I, lacking the innate understanding I had of the world around me for a reason I cannot explain, and even still I had never heard of a weapon. As if in response to my objection my creator once again demonstrated his power.
Images began pouring into my mind with many sticks of wood and stone of many different sizes and shapes. They seemed strange and impractical at first, but then the images of the things in use began to play. It was all capped off with a hammer smashing a snow white gemstone. So that was his goal, there is another. What I had failed to notice while I was distracted by the blur of images and actions a blue mist had crept around me and seeped into my mind.
I tried to rip away control like last time but no matter how hard I tried I couldn't resist. "Relax Creation, I merely want to test if I can use magic in your form." At these words I thought back to his promise to protect me with the smoke. Is he really saying he didn't know if it would work back then? I don't get another chance to resist however as he takes control of my very will and begins to move it through a particular pattern. He drains me of a large portion of my energy and brings it to my hand, before releasing it in a stream of water.

"Interesting" The voice says, "And it even used your mana instead of mine." I can feel the second mind sitting atop mine, ruminating but letting no more of its thoughts reach me. "I shall teach you how to do this yourself when you get back, for now I have things to do." the weight atop me finally lifts and though I am tired I rush out the door. Maybe if I leave a bigger offering he will leave me alone.
Aquamarine
Ok, now I know that even if I can't get them weapons I can teach them magic. That is good. Now if only I could figure out a way to make my water attack lethal. I could just keep adding more water and more power but at as I am now it will be such an awful trade off it wont even be worth using. For now though, I need to speed up my progress. I didn't see any signs of creatures in the white gems domain, so if I make 3 more Humamanders I should outpace it by enough to get the edge on it and destroy it.
With the fruits in front of me I should be able to give each of them enough mana to put them on par with Humamander. After I finish off that white core my next priority is definitely thinking of a better name for those things.
So I grabbed one of the fruits and begin consuming it as I summoned a Humamander. This one was slightly smaller than the original when he was born. Repeating the action I summoned another, this one the same size as the original when he was born. I then summoned a third, this one being as large as the original is now. I named them three four and five respectively. I would think off names later, but the existential threat at hand has hampered my creativity.
I use the remaining fruit to summon fish for the new arrivals to eat while I wait for the other two Humamanders to return.
